2 Description
IFE magnet vibrators are used to generate directed oscillations for driving vibrating conveyor troughs,
vibrating conveyor tubes and screening machines.
The IFE magnet vibrator and vibratory equipment (work load) together form an oscillating system consisting
of two masses. The oscillation excitation of the system occurs through the pulsating force of the drive
magnets which are connected to the AC power supply via an IFE thyristor controller or regulation device.
The size of the oscillating width can be steplessly controlled during operation.
IFE magnet vibrators are robust constructions and their completely enclosed design is protects against dust
and splash water.

In case the machine will be in an intermediate storage after delivery, before the assembling itself, please
follow the instructions:
- Preferably store in a dry shop.
- Protect all electrical equipment and their replacement parts against humidity, direct sunlight, aggressive
atmospheres and temperatures below -20 °C and over +70 °C.
ATTENTION
The storage of electric devices is not permitted out of doors! (with the exception of the
built-on drives of the machine)
If the machine is stored outdoors temporarily, it must be placed on wooden planks and
covered with a waterproof tarpaulin, left open on the bottom (to allow condensation
water to run off).
S410041R02-e-101124 Page 9
Magnet vibrator Type TS
All bare machine parts were coated with a corrosion protection at the factory. This protection is effective for
approx. 3 months. If the machine is stored intermediately for longer than this, the corrosion protection must
be renewed in due time.
- If rust should form anywhere, it must be properly treated immediately.
- Lubricate all bare machine parts with a suitable acid-free machine oil.

ATTENTION
Screw connections can loosen under vibration. These connections and couplings must
therefore be checked at regular intervals and be retightened when necessary.
The magnet vibrators must be fitted on a clean, level (levelness: 0.3), and vibration-free base, if possible with
a machined surface. Use only the supplied threaded bolts to attach the magnet vibrators, according to the
specifications in the construction and/or assembly drawing in the appendix.
ATTENTION
Magnet vibrator and work load are designed and adjusted for each other (dual-mass
oscillation system). The magnet vibrator is matched to a specific work load weight and
may only be mounted on a work load with the specified tuning weight.
1. Screw in the threaded bolts (Pos. 2 - Figure 3) into the saddle holder of the magnet vibrator.
2. Raise the magnet vibrator up to the vibratory equipment and thread in the threaded bolts into the
motor mounts.
S410041R02-e-101124 Page 11
Magnet vibrator Type TS
3. Slide on plate (Pos. 1 - Figure 3) and washers (Pos. 3 - Figure 3) and bolt together with nuts
(Pos. 4 - Figure 3). See Table 3 for tightening torque.

ATTENTION
Electric welding on parts, which are connected to the IFE vibratory equipment through
metallic connection, may only be carried out if the connection cable from the
connection unit to the magnet vibrator is disconnected (U, V, PE), (Figure 4). Welding
current flowing over the connection unit would result in its destruction!

ATTENTION
Perform the following checks for switching on the machine for the first time.
- Check the installation of the devices according to the data in these Operating Instructions and if
applicable in the assembly design.
- Conformance of the technical data of the order confirmation, the bill of delivery and all name plates.
- Conformance of the electrical data with the figures of your electricity network (voltage, frequency, power
input and cable diameter).
- Conformance of the effective cable running with the terminal connection plan (especially the interlocking
with other machines).
- Check of the sealing of the threaded cable connections.
- Check of the complete removal of all transport brace supports and devices.
- Check whether all safety covers are installed and in a perfect condition.
- Check all bolts/screws for tightness, particularly mounting bolts, safety covering bolts/screws and
suspension mounting bolts.

Procedure:
The three adjustment bolts (or nuts) of the magnet carrying frame or yoke are adjusted to the specified
dimension (see Figure 7) and tightened.
Figure 7
x Adjusting dimension
1 Yoke
2 Adjustment bolt
Here, the fourth adjusting bolt must be loose (Figure 8) to prevent a distortion of the bolts.
Figure 8
1 Tighten the three bolts
2 Tighten the fourth bolt free from distortion
The value at the fourth adjustment bolt is measured in the loose state this must also be maintained after the
tightening. e.g.: Three points in the tighten state 3.2 mm, the fourth point still loose 3.1 mm. Adjust point 4 so
that the 3.1 mm is maintained after tightening.
Page 24 S410041R02-e-101124
Magnet vibrator Type TS
If striker bolts are present (for TS500 and TS1000) these are subsequently adjusted by 0.3 mm less than the
air gap (Figure 9).
